Argue in Private but Keep a United Front in Public
MANILA, Philippines — We are used to dirty laundry being often aired in politics, which is tiresome for a nation that yearns for leaders to act with dignity and honor. It is disappointing when the same thing happens in family businesses.
Integrity includes the discipline to resolve conflicts behind closed doors and present a cohesive, respectful front to the outside world. This approach not only preserves the reputation of the individuals involved but also upholds the trust and confidence of those who look up to them.
